My son has acne on his face. What should he do?

I took him to a med spa and the doctor there put him on antibiotics, gave him Glytone to use and also gave him a series of micro dermabrasions, chemical peels and a laser treatment. I then got a referral to a dermatologist from our medical insurance and that doctor wants him to wash with Dove, use Benzoyl Peroxide, Retin A and antibiotic and couldn't understand why I would take him for micro dermabrasions and peels. Who do I believe?
